For the second week in a row, a team has plucked a quarterback from the Patriots practice squad.
According to NFL Network's Tom Pelissero, the Chargers have signed quarterback Will Grier to their active roster on Monday.
The Patriots signed Grier to their own active roster in late September off of Cincinnati's practice squad, but ultimately never activated him for a game. He served as the team's scout-team quarterback as well as their emergency third quarterback on game-day a handful of times, but was waived on November 25th to make room for OT Conor McDermott. Grier then signed back to the practice squad the following week. He now heads to Los Angeles.
Just last Tuesday, the Baltimore Ravens signed practice squad QB/WR Malik Cunningham from the Patriots' practice squad after the former Louisville signal caller had boomeranged on and off of their active roster.
New England will likely look to make a move at signal caller in the near future as they now have multiple open spots on their practice squad. They worked out former Brown QB E.J. Perry last week. That could be a name to watch for.
